Olympus SP-810 UZ vs Samsung NX5 Overview

Below is a thorough assessment of the Olympus SP-810 UZ vs Samsung NX5, former being a Small Sensor Superzoom while the latter is a Entry-Level Mirrorless by manufacturers Olympus and Samsung. The sensor resolution of the SP-810 UZ (14MP) and the NX5 (15MP) is relatively close but the SP-810 UZ (1/2.3") and NX5 (APS-C) enjoy totally different sensor dimensions.

The SP-810 UZ was revealed 15 months later than the NX5 which makes the cameras a generation apart from each other. Each of these cameras come with different body type with the Olympus SP-810 UZ being a SLR-like (bridge) camera and the Samsung NX5 being a SLR-style mirrorless camera.

Olympus SP-810 UZ vs Samsung NX5 Physical Comparison

In case you're going to lug around your camera, you should factor its weight and proportions. The Olympus SP-810 UZ provides outer dimensions of 106mm x 76mm x 74mm (4.2" x 3.0" x 2.9") along with a weight of 413 grams (0.91 lbs) and the Samsung NX5 has measurements of 123mm x 87mm x 40mm (4.8" x 3.4" x 1.6") and a weight of 499 grams (1.10 lbs).

Olympus SP-810 UZ vs Samsung NX5 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it can be tough to visualise the contrast in sensor measurements purely by viewing technical specs. The visual below will provide you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the SP-810 UZ and NX5.

As you can tell, both cameras have got different resolutions and different sensor measurements. The SP-810 UZ having a smaller sensor will make achieving shallower depth of field trickier and the Samsung NX5 will result in extra detail because of its extra 1 Megapixels. Higher resolution will allow you to crop photographs much more aggressively. The more modern SP-810 UZ is going to have an advantage with regard to sensor tech.
